Subject: Re: [net-next 01/16] ixgbe: add check for netif_carrier_ok in ixgbe_xmit_frame

> diff --git a/drivers/net/ethernet/intel/ixgbe/ixgbe_main.c b/drivers/net/ethernet/intel/ixgbe/ixgbe_main.c
> index 851c413..8bea6ca 100644
> --- a/drivers/net/ethernet/intel/ixgbe/ixgbe_main.c
> +++ b/drivers/net/ethernet/intel/ixgbe/ixgbe_main.c
> @@ -7121,6 +7121,11 @@ static netdev_tx_t __ixgbe_xmit_frame(struct sk_buff *skb,
>  	struct ixgbe_adapter *adapter = netdev_priv(netdev);
>  	struct ixgbe_ring *tx_ring;
>  
> +	if (!netif_carrier_ok(netdev)) {
> +		dev_kfree_skb_any(skb);
> +		return NETDEV_TX_OK;
> +	}
> +

I would much prefer that this check moves into netpoll's direct invocation of
->ndo_start_xmit().

Otherwise every driver will start to add this check and that kind of
duplication doesn't make any sense at all.
